Bridge destruction to reveal clues about 'fracture-critical' spans

Thursday, July 28, 2011 - 04:30 in Earth & Climate

A civil engineer at Purdue University is taking advantage of the demolition of a bridge spanning the Ohio River to learn more about how bridges collapse in efforts to reduce the annual cost of inspecting large spans.
